学习时,使用IDEA开发Java的时候,有不少经常使用到的设置。下面介绍idea的经常使用到的设置。

idea常用设置介绍的目录

  • 一、 设置面板目录概览
    • 1.1 设置面板打开方式
    • 1.2 各部分作用
  • 二、 自定义背景字体
    • 2.1 自定义背景样式
    • 2.2 自定义字体大小
  • 三、 修改代码提示
  • 四、 自动导入包功能
  • 五、 代码缩进及编码设置
    • 5.1 设置代码缩进
    • 5.2 设置全局编码

一、 设置面板目录概览

简介:介绍设置面板各部分的作用。

1.1 设置面板打开方式

  1. 选择 File --> Settings
  2. 快捷键:ctrl + alt + s

1.2 各部分作用

打开设置面板,熟悉各部分的作用

  1. Appearance & Behavior ( 外观和行为 )
    配置主题、字体、字号、工具类,以及其他视图工具。

  2. keymap ( 快捷键 )
    创建,编辑和删除特定环境的自定义键盘映射,并更改与操作相关联的快捷键。

  3. Editor ( 编辑器 )
    与编辑器相关,主要包括常用设置、字体、模板等。

  4. Plugins ( 插件 )
    与插件相关。

  5. Version Control ( 版本控制 )
    与版本控制相关,包括csv、git、svn等。

  6. Build,Execution,DeployMent ( 构建,执行,部署 )
    与构建,执行,部署相关的一些设置。

  7. Languages & FrameWorks ( 语言和框架 )
    与语言和框架相关的设置,各种各类的语言。

  8. Tools ( 工具集 )
    各种工具集设置,包括但不限于浏览器、ssh终端等。

  9. Other Settings ( 其他设置 )
    与自定义插件相关。

  10. Experimental ( 实验的设置 )
    该部分是为那些被认为是实验性的特性设置的。

二、 自定义背景字体

简介:介绍如何设置背景和字体。

2.1 自定义背景样式

按快捷键 ctrl + shift + a ,在弹出的窗口中输入 set ,选择 Set Background Image


弹出设置框,熟悉各部分作用

  1. 选择背景图
  2. 调整透明度
  3. 设置背景图是否仅是当前项目用(勾选了则是仅用于当前项目)
  4. 背景图展示的位置
  5. 效果预览
  6. 清除当前设置的背景并关闭

背景设置好后

2.2 自定义字体大小

打开设置面板,搜索 Font ,修改 Size 的大小

三、 修改代码提示

简介:介绍如何设置代码提示时忽略大小写。

打开设置面板, 选择 Editor --> General --> Code Completion


选项的区别:

  1. First letter only :从首字母匹配你输入的字符串,区分大小写。
  2. All letters : 在代码中匹配含有你输入的字符串,区分大小写。
  3. Match case :如果不勾选,则是在代码中匹配含有你输入的字符串,不区分大小写。

四、 自动导入包功能

简介:介绍如何在平时开发时自动导入包。

打开设置面板,选择 Editor --> General --> auto import ,勾选这两个空

五、 代码缩进及编码设置

简介:介绍如何设置代码缩进和全局文件编码。

5.1 设置代码缩进

打开设置面板, 选择 Editor --> Code Style --> Java

不要勾选 Use tab character , Indent 保持 4

5.2 设置全局编码

打开设置面板,选择 Editor --> File Encodings

Global EncodingProject EncodingDefault encoding for properties files 这三个地方,都设置成 UTF-8

好了,继续学习。

idea常使用到的设置操作使用介绍相关推荐

  1. 供来宾访问计算机打开安全吗,计算机安全设置操作手册(22页)-原创力文档

    计算机安全设置操作手册 ISO27001项目实施 电脑配置 (以XP为例) 账户设置 user每台电脑设置administrator和user帐户:管理员账户密码至少 8位, 账户至少6位 user ...

  2. 【C++】C++11 STL算法(五):设置操作(Set operations)、堆操作(Heap operations)

    目录 设置操作(Set operations) 一.includes 1.原型: 2.说明: 3.官方demo 二.set_difference 1.原型: 2.说明: 3.官方demo 三.set_ ...

  3. oracle tax 中国税,oracle_TAX_税基础设置操作手册.doc

    您所在位置:网站首页 > 海量文档 &nbsp>&nbsp计算机&nbsp>&nbsp数据库 oracle_TAX_税基础设置操作手册.doc21页 ...

  4. jupyter notebook python怎么设置_jupyter notebook 的工作空间设置操作

    Jupyter notebook 安装后,启动后,默认的工作空间是当前用户目录.为了方便对文档进行管理,往往需要自行设置工作空间.下面介绍一种便捷的工作空间设置方法. 对 Jupyter notebo ...

  5. 三星s20计算机怎么添加到桌面,三星s20+怎么分屏?三星s20系列多窗口分屏设置操作步骤...

    三星s20+怎么分屏?三星s20系列多窗口分屏设置操作步骤来讲一讲吧,三星S20是一款屏幕体验超好的智能手机,它可以运行多窗口,让我们在分屏视图上同时运行两个应用程序.比如我们能一边聊天,一边看视频, ...

  6. 计算机无法保存其他共享用户,Win7共享打印机出现 无法保存打印机设置 操作无法完成 错误0x000006d9解决方法...

    Win7共享打印机出现 无法保存打印机设置 操作无法完成 错误0x000006d9解决方法 发布时间:2012-10-19 14:25:18   作者:佚名   我要评论 以下为常见的WIN7共享打印 ...

  7. springboot调整请求头大小_SpringBoot http post请求数据大小设置操作

    背景: 使用http post请求方式的接口,使用request.getParameter("XXX");的方法获取参数的值,当数据量超过几百k的时候,接口接收不到数据或者接收为n ...

  8. Win7共享打印机 出现 “ 无法保存打印机设置 操作无法完成(错误 0x000006d9)“

    Win7共享打印机 出现 " 无法保存打印机设置 操作无法完成(错误 0x000006d9)" Windows7中在共享打印机时,出现错误提示:无法保存打印机设置 操作无法完成(错 ...

  9. 索尼g16c蓝牙耳机怎么设置语言,【索尼 SBH50 智能蓝牙耳机使用感受】软件|连接|设置|操作|功能_摘要频道_什么值得买...

    索尼 SBH50 智能蓝牙耳机使用感受(软件|连接|设置|操作|功能) 第一操作:安装手机软件 软件安装在手机里面![注明:必须是安卓手机才能使用软件功能!] [SBH50手机驱动] [安卓手机(智慧 ...

最新文章

  1. web安全之token
  2. 相机上的AE AF AWB AEB都表示的是什么?
  3. maven项目下tomcat直接启动不了(LifecycleException)。报错如下截图
  4. 关于java的JIT知识
  5. 基于Ubuntu+Owncloud的私有云网盘
  6. 电脑打字手指正确姿势_正确的投篮姿势教学,许多人都忽略的细节,学会变投篮神射手...
  7. 什么是SVC模式【转】
  8. 2014年考研英语一翻译知识点
  9. C语言和C++的区别整理详解!
  10. python脚本如何编译_如何编译用于FORTRAN的Python脚本?
  11. 【原】android获取设备基本信息
  12. 华为云MVP:来自工业制造领域的微服务与云平台实践
  13. python多用户登录_python多用户
  14. python 机器学习——从感知机算法到各种最优化方法的应用(python)
  15. nc 单据模板公式
  16. 美国区块链与药品供应链管理的应用案例
  17. ftp怎么用计算机打开 不用浏览器打开,win7 访问ftp站点 不用浏览器显示
  18. c语言other用法,other的用法总结
  19. 图画日记怎么画_画画提高的一个方法: 绘画日记!
  20. 第五届“强网”拟态防御国际精英挑战赛在南京举行——开辟网络安全新赛道 引领网络弹性新优势

热门文章

  1. 图像去雾学习(一):“暗通道”是什么
  2. 微信营销20招让你粉丝过万 转载
  3. 留几手被毙掉的互联网演讲稿
  4. 中国移动ML302模组(4G Cat.1 通信模组)TencentOS-tiny AT模组框架适配
  5. 计算机机房使用什么加湿器,机房空调加湿器和加湿灌有什么区别?安装时需要满足哪些条件?...
  6. 国内DNS劫持与污染状况分析
  7. canon 计数器清零软件
  8. H3C 交换机 查看debugging
  9. 用jQuery实现简单的抽奖页面
  10. spring的延迟加载介绍